The anhydride of an alcohol is :

A

Ether

B

Aldehyde

C

Alkanoic anhydride

D

Alkoxides

To determine the anhydride of an alcohol, we need to understand the concept of anhydrides and how they relate to alcohols. Let's break down the solution step by step. ### Step 1: Understand the Definition of Anhydride An anhydride is formed when a compound loses a molecule of water (H₂O). This is a key concept in identifying what the anhydride of an alcohol would be. **Hint:** Remember that anhydrides are formed by the removal of water from two molecules of a compound. ### Step 2: Identify the Structure of Alcohol An alcohol can be represented by the general formula R-OH, where R is an alkyl group. **Hint:** Recall the general structure of alcohols and how they are represented in chemical formulas. ### Step 3: Consider Two Molecules of Alcohol To form an anhydride, we need two molecules of alcohol. So, we have: - First alcohol: R-OH - Second alcohol: R'-OH **Hint:** Think about how two molecules of the same or different alcohols can interact to form a new compound. ### Step 4: Remove Water from the Alcohols When these two alcohol molecules react, a water molecule (H₂O) is removed. The reaction can be represented as: - R-OH + R'-OH → ROR' + H₂O This reaction shows that the hydroxyl (OH) from one alcohol and the hydrogen (H) from the other alcohol combine to form water, leaving behind the ether structure. **Hint:** Visualize the reaction and remember that the removal of H₂O is crucial for forming the anhydride. ### Step 5: Identify the Product The product of this reaction is ROR', which is the structure of an ether. Therefore, the anhydride of an alcohol is an ether. **Hint:** Compare the resulting structure (ROR') with the definitions of the given options to confirm your answer. ### Conclusion Based on the above steps, we conclude that the anhydride of an alcohol is an ether. **Final Answer:** The anhydride of an alcohol is **ether** (Option A).
